I would leave the following review:
"Unfortunately, XX could not make the reservation due to personal reasons which she did communciate to me. I cannot comment on her cleanliness or following house rules as I did not actually host her. The communication I had with her was quick, thorough, and cordial. It was generous of her to offer to pay for the evening since at that point I was unable to rent the room. I look forward to hosting XX in the future."
